La création d'expériences VR avec A-Frame sur un MacBook Pro M4 implique plusieurs étapes, de la configuration de votre environnement au déploiement de votre contenu VR. Voici un guide détaillé pour vous aider à démarrer:
Configuration de votre environnement
1. Installez A-Frame: Commencez par visiter le site Web A-Frame et l'incluez-le dans votre fichier HTML. Vous pouvez le faire en ajoutant la balise de script A-Frame à la tête de votre document HTML. A-Frame est un cadre qui facilite la création d'expériences VR basées sur le Web.
2. Choisissez un éditeur de texte: Utilisez un éditeur de texte comme Visual Studio Code ou SUBLIME Text pour écrire votre code HTML et JavaScript.
3. Configurer un serveur local: Pour tester vos expériences VR localement, vous aurez besoin d'un serveur local. Vous pouvez utiliser des outils comme «Live-Server» ou «Http-Server» pour servir vos fichiers.
Création d'une scène de base de base
1. Créez une scène A-Frame: commencez par une scène de base en A en définissant un élément `` dans votre fichier HTML. Ce sera le conteneur de tous vos éléments VR.
2. Ajouter des actifs: vous pouvez ajouter des modèles, des images ou des vidéos 3D à votre scène en utilisant diverses primitives en A comme ``, ``, ou ``.
3. Ajouter la caméra et les commandes: utilisez l'élément `` pour définir la position et l'orientation de la caméra. Vous pouvez également ajouter des contrôles tels que la rotation ou le mouvement à l'aide des composants intégrés du trame A.
Activation du mode VR
1. Activer le mode VR: pour entrer en mode VR, vous avez généralement besoin d'un casque VR et d'un navigateur compatible. Cependant, comme vous travaillez sur un MacBook, vous n'avez peut-être pas accès direct au matériel VR. Au lieu de cela, vous pouvez simuler des expériences VR à l'aide d'outils tels que l'inspecteur de A-Frame ou en testant sur d'autres appareils.
2. Test sur d'autres appareils: Si vous avez accès à un appareil Android ou à une autre configuration compatible VR, vous pouvez y tester votre expérience VR. Pour les appareils iOS, il y a des problèmes connus avec la prise en charge de WebXR, vous devrez donc peut-être utiliser des solutions de contournement comme des versions plus anciennes de configurations en A ou spécifiques [1].
Développement et test
1. Débogage: utilisez l'inspecteur de trame A pour déboguer votre scène. Vous pouvez y accéder en appuyant sur `Ctrl + Alt + I` (Windows / Linux) ou` CMD + OPT + I` (Mac) tout en affichant votre scène dans un navigateur.
2. Tester sur différentes plates-formes: si vous prévoyez de déployer votre expérience VR sur diverses plates-formes, assurez-vous qu'elle fonctionne sur différents navigateurs et appareils. Pour iOS, vous pouvez rencontrer des problèmes en raison d'un support WebXR limité, alors envisagez d'utiliser des versions de trame A plus anciennes ou des méthodes alternatives [1].
Conclusion
La création d'expériences VR avec A-Frame sur un MacBook Pro M4 est possible, mais vous devrez peut-être simuler ou tester les fonctionnalités VR sur d'autres appareils en raison de limitations matérielles. En suivant ces étapes et en s'adaptant à tous les défis spécifiques à la plate-forme, vous pouvez développer un contenu VR engageant à l'aide d'un cadre A.
Citations:[1] https://stackoverflow.com/questions/73073300/what-work-arounds-exist-to-make-aframe-vr-work-on-an-iphone-or-other-iso-mibile
[2] https://plugable.com/blogs/news/plugable-products-tetested-and-approved-for-the-apple-m4-macbook-pro
[3] https://www.youtube.com/watch?v=tgn-wl2dpry
[4] https://learn.framevr.io/post/apple-vision-pro
[5] https://zeerawireless.com/blogs/news/mac-mini-m4-pro-compatibilité-display-support-resolutions-and-iphone-ipad-intelegration
[6] https://arvrjourney.com/build-a-vr-website-using-aframe-step-by-step-guide-parti-1-37d0437b4e3e
[7] https://www.reddit.com/r/oculus/comments/rvrkx1/unity_vr_development_with_a_macbook_pro_apple_m1/
[8] https://support.apple.com/en-us/121553
[9] https://learn.framevr.io/resources